In the still of the night
I hear your footsteps,
They're edging nearer.
I turn over in my bed
And face the door.
There you stand -
Your teddy in your arms,
Your face full of fear.

"Can I sleep with you, Mommy?"
You ask, inching towards my bed.
I open up the cover
And watch as you climb in beside me.

The warmth of your body is comforting;
The sound of your breathing, calming.
I run my fingers through your hair
And wonder what my life would be like
Without you in it.
And I realise, that I never want to know.
I want you to be by my side
Until the end of time.

I watch as you drift off to sleep,
Your face as pure and innocent
As an angel,
And I think about all the hardships
We have had to endure,
And I hope that you realise
Just how much I love you.
I hope that you will forgive me
For all the wrong I've done.
And I really hope
That you love me too,
Because a love
As pure as what you give,
Is better than that
Of any man in the world!
